Description

Are you a systems architect who thrives in high-velocity environments, crafting solutions that redefine efficiency?

At Trilogy, operational mastery is our secret weapon. We rapidly acquire and scale software companies, demanding executives who can engineer streamlined, automated systems—not merely manage complexity via manpower.

In this pivotal role, you'll drive comprehensive transformations across our global portfolio. Whether it's streamlining the offboarding of 1,200+ employees post-acquisition, replacing Jira and Salesforce with AI-driven solutions, or creating automations that save thousands of manual hours, you'll be executing with speed using Python, LLM APIs, and tools like Cursor, Windsurf, and MCP—backed by a suite of proven playbooks focused on results.

Trilogy operates a vast 100+ product portfolio with unmatched efficiency. We cut through layers, accelerate cycles, and set higher benchmarks than traditional enterprises. This is your opportunity to make a large-scale impact without the hindrance of bureaucracy or oversized teams.

We eschew steady-state operations, outsourcing transformations, and hiring those who need teams or permission to perform. We seek a select few deeply technical, execution-driven leaders who wield automation as a tool and speed as their strategy. If this resonates with you, you'll excel in our environment.

What you will be doing

  • Executing complex operational projects like M&A integrations, enterprise system migrations, and large-scale organizational transitions
  • Designing and implementing automations that replace CRM and task management tools using Python and LLM APIs
  • Deploying AI-powered workflows with tools like Cursor, Windsurf, and MCP to eliminate manual tasks and reduce latency
  • Leading projects from diagnosis through to deployment, applying proven playbooks and executive-level decision-making
  • Tackling a hands-on technical challenge to showcase your capability in creating AI-first solutions

What you will NOT be doing

  • Managing large teams or depending on multiple layers of personnel to achieve objectives
  • Participating in endless alignment meetings or requiring consensus to make progress
  • Delegating challenging tasks to IT or external vendors—you'll be responsible for architecting and executing solutions
  • Maintaining steady-state operations—this role is centered on transformation and rapid execution

Key responsibilities

Design and implement AI-driven operational systems that eradicate manual labor, streamline complexity, and facilitate scalable execution across Trilogy’s expansive software portfolio.

Candidate requirements

  • Located in North America (excluding California), South/Central America, or Western Europe (UTC -8 to UTC +2)
  • 5+ years in operational leadership within enterprise software
  • 3+ years in customer-facing roles (Support, Sales, Collections, etc.)
  • Proven proficiency in writing automation scripts in Python and integrating with LLM APIs
  • Experience utilizing Cursor, Windsurf, MCP, or similar tools to deliver production-grade automations
  • Demonstrated ability to act swiftly, think autonomously, and achieve significant results without supervision

Nice to have

  • Experience in leading large-scale organizational changes such as M&A integrations or mass offboarding
  • Track record of designing and deploying AI-driven operational systems
  • Portfolio showcasing automations you've developed and deployed at scale
